ErrorResponseCode

Codici di errore

Enum
UNKNOWN_ERROR_RESPONSE_CODE Non impostare questo valore predefinito.
INVALID_API_VERSION Utilizzato se la versione API della richiesta non è supportata. Codice HTTP consigliato: 400
INVALID_PAYLOAD_SIGNATURE Utilizzato se la firma del payload è a una chiave sconosciuta o inattiva. Codice HTTP consigliato: 401
INVALID_PAYLOAD_ENCRYPTION Utilizzato se la crittografia del payload è eseguita su una chiave sconosciuta o inattiva. Codice HTTP consigliato: 400
REQUEST_TIMESTAMP_OUT_OF_RANGE Utilizzato se requesttimestamp non è di ± 60 secondi. Codice HTTP consigliato: 400
INVALID_IDENTIFIER Utilizzato se un identificatore inviato nella richiesta non è valido o è sconosciuto. Queste possono includere PIAID, CaptureRequestId, Google Payment Token e così via. Il tipo di identificatore non valido deve essere specificato in errorDescription. Codice HTTP consigliato: 404
IDEMPOTENCY_VIOLATION Utilizzato se la richiesta viola i requisiti di idempotency della richiesta. Codice HTTP consigliato: 412
INVALID_FIELD_VALUE Utilizzato se la richiesta contiene un valore che non rientra nell'insieme dei valori supportati. Codice HTTP consigliato: 400
MISSING_REQUIRED_FIELD Utilizzato se un campo obbligatorio non è impostato nella richiesta. Codice HTTP consigliato: 400
PRECONDITION_VIOLATION Utilizzato in caso di violazione di un vincolo sull'operazione (ad esempio, quando una richiesta di rimborso supera l'importo residuo della transazione). Codice HTTP consigliato: 400
USER_ACTION_IN_PROGRESS Utilizzato se al momento non è possibile elaborare la richiesta perché interrompe un'azione dell'utente in corso che funge effettivamente da blocco del sistema. Questo codice non deve essere utilizzato per indicare errori dovuti a errori di contemporaneità interni specifici dell'implementazione. Codice HTTP consigliato: 423
INVALID_DECRYPTED_REQUEST Utilizzato se è stato possibile decriptare il payload della richiesta, ma non è stato possibile analizzare il messaggio risultante. Codice HTTP consigliato: 400
FORBIDDEN L'accesso alla risorsa richiesta è vietato. Codice HTTP consigliato: 403